Megalodon: The Largest Shark to Ever Exist in History
The Megalodon (Carcharocles megalodon) is widely recognized as the largest shark to have ever existed, dominating the seas millions of years ago. This massive predator lived during the Cenozoic Era, specifically from the late Oligocene to the early Pleistocene epochs, approximately 23 to 3.6 million years ago. With its colossal size and formidable hunting abilities, the Megalodon was at the apex of the marine food chain, rivaling even the largest whales of its time. Fossils suggest that this shark played a crucial role in shaping marine ecosystems, influencing the evolution of other species.
Gigantic Size: Megalodon Could Reach Over 60 Feet Long
Estimates suggest that Megalodon could reach lengths of over 60 feet (approximately 18 meters), making it an incredible sight in ancient oceans. Some researchers propose that its size may have even exceeded 80 feet, rivaling the length of a modern-day blue whale, which is the largest animal alive today. The sheer scale of the Megalodon is not only a testament to its evolutionary success but also reflects its adaptations for hunting large prey. Its enormous size provided advantages in both predation and defense against other marine animals, ensuring its position as a dominant force in the oceans.
Fossil Evidence: Megalodon Teeth Are Over 7 Inches Big
One of the most compelling pieces of evidence for the existence of Megalodon is its fossilized teeth, which can measure over 7 inches (approximately 18 cm) in length. These teeth, with their serrated edges, were perfectly designed for gripping and tearing flesh, indicating that Megalodon was a powerful predator. Unlike bones, which are often less likely to be preserved, shark teeth are abundant in the fossil record, allowing scientists to study the distribution and evolution of this species. The size and structure of Megalodon teeth provide invaluable insight into its feeding habits and ecological role.

Diet Details: Megalodon Feasted on Whales and Large Prey
Megalodon’s diet primarily consisted of large marine animals, including whales, seals, and other sizable fish. Fossil evidence, such as bite marks on whale bones, suggests that the Megalodon had a preference for large prey, using its immense jaws and sharp teeth to capture and consume them. This predatory behavior not only highlights the Megalodon’s role as a top predator but also underscores its impact on the marine ecosystem, influencing the population dynamics of its prey. The Megalodon’s ability to hunt such large animals is a remarkable adaptation that contributed to its dominance.
Teeth Comparison: Megalodon’s Size Outmatches Great White
When comparing teeth, Megalodon’s have an unmistakable advantage over those of the Great White Shark (Carcharodon carcharias). While Great Whites possess teeth that typically measure around 3 inches (approximately 7.5 cm), Megalodon teeth can exceed 7 inches, showcasing a significant difference in size and functionality. The larger teeth of the Megalodon were not only capable of inflicting devastating wounds but also indicate the size of prey it was adapted to hunt. This stark contrast emphasizes the Megalodon’s role as a super predator in its environment.
Habitat Range: Megalodon Roamed Warm Ocean Waters Globally
Megalodon inhabited warm ocean waters across the globe, thriving in both coastal and deeper marine environments. Fossils have been discovered on every continent, indicating a vast geographic distribution that may have been influenced by varying ocean temperatures and its preference for warmer waters. This broad habitat range allowed Megalodon to exploit diverse ecosystems and prey, thereby enhancing its ecological success. The presence of Megalodon in different marine habitats also suggests an adaptability that enabled it to thrive in changing environmental conditions.
Extinction Theories: Climate Change Might Have Contributed
While the exact cause of Megalodon’s extinction remains a topic of debate, several theories have emerged, with climate change being a significant factor. As the Earth entered the Pleistocene epoch, ocean temperatures began to drop, leading to a reduction in the populations of large marine prey, such as whales. Additionally, shifts in ocean currents and habitats may have further strained the Megalodon’s ability to find suitable food sources. These environmental changes, coupled with increased competition from other marine predators, likely contributed to the decline of this once-mighty shark.
